Every construction site is a dynamic and fast-paced environment where unexpected challenges arise daily. From unpredictable weather to design modifications and material shortages, construction workers must adapt quickly to keep projects moving forward. Managing time, materials, and labor efficiently is crucial to ensuring that projects stay on schedule and within budget.
– Unpredictable Weather Conditions
📌 Rain, extreme heat, or cold temperatures can delay work, making weather one of the biggest challenges in construction. Planning for seasonal conditions and using weather-resistant materials helps minimize disruptions.
– Last-Minute Design Changes
📌 Client requests or engineering adjustments can lead to unexpected modifications. Quick coordination between architects, engineers, and workers is essential to integrate changes without causing major delays.
– Labor Shortages & Coordination
📌 Skilled labor shortages can slow down progress. Efficient workforce management, proper training, and clear communication among teams are key to maintaining productivity on-site.
– Material Delays & Supply Chain Issues
📌 Delays in material deliveries can halt construction. Establishing strong supplier relationships, ordering materials in advance, and having backup suppliers can help prevent setbacks.
– Safety Risks & Compliance
📌 Construction sites are inherently hazardous. Ensuring strict safety protocols, regular training, and protective equipment are in place can help prevent accidents and keep workers safe.
– Budget Constraints & Cost Overruns
📌 Rising material costs, unexpected expenses, or inefficient planning can impact the budget. Proper cost estimation, detailed project planning, and monitoring expenses are critical to staying financially on track.
